Compensation

This position includes a guaranteed hourly base rate plus productivity-based earnings:

  • Base Pay: $14.50 per hour (paid for all hours worked)
  • Productivity Pay: $30.00 per billable “hit” 

Employees are expected to meet a minimum productivity target of 28 hits per week.

At full-time status (40 hours/week), employees who meet this standard productivity expectation typically earn:

  • Base Pay: Approximately $1,160 per pay period
  • Productivity Pay: Approximately $1,680 per pay period

Additional Information:

  • Productivity pay is based on completed, billable services
  • Total compensation will vary based on actual productivity and hours worked
  • Opportunities exist to earn more by exceeding productivity expectations
